The rapid advancement of AIGC technology is putting multiple positions at risk of being replaced, forcing educators to reconsider the essence and purpose of education - how to cultivate students’ core competencies that cannot be easily replaced in the future society. At the same time, AIGC also brings great potential to educators in improving teaching efficiency and enriching teaching methods, which also indicates that future education will be a new model of human-machine collaboration and complementary advantages. In this transformation process, teachers need to deeply reflect and clarify their own positioning, explore which functions should be undertaken by “human teachers” and which can be efficiently completed by “pilots”, in order to optimize educational resources and maximize teaching effectiveness. This paper focuses on the programming course in computer fundamentals, and explores the impact and changes of artificial intelligence on the content of programming courses.
